Japanese pilot forgets to lower landing gear
Posted 19 minutes ago on abc.net.au A 57-year-old pilot on a training flight has escaped injury after forgetting to extend his landing gear when touching down at an airport in Kobe, western Japan. "I forgot to put down the landing gear," restaurant owner Yoshihiko Yamamoto, who has logged 400 flying hours since obtaining his pilot's licence in 1977, was quoted as telling police. He was flying a privately owned, single-engine six-seat Beechcraft aircraft with no-one else on board when it landed mid-morning at Kobe's main airport. The airport was closed for two-and-a-half hours, delaying nine commercial flights up to four hours and inconveniencing some 1,200 travellers, Kyodo news agency reported.
